Tender description

Under the CIPFA Code of Practice on Local Authority Accounting, Cherwell District Council (CDC) is required to undertake professional valuation of any asset it holds under the revaluation model (IAS16 and IAS40, as adapted by the CIPFA code) for financial reporting purposes. The valuations are required to be undertaken by suitably qualified valuation professionals and at a frequency that ensures the book values declared in the Council's accounts are current and materially accurate. The council intends to operate a 3-year valuation schedule to ensure that the values remain current and materially correct.
